Usage guidelines and best practices
To maximize results, apply the product to a cool, dry cooktop and work in small sections with circular motions. For glass-ceramic surfaces, avoid abrasive pads that can scratch; instead, use the included pad or a non-scratch cloth for buffing. Always finish with a dry microfiber to remove any remaining haze. Heat management matters: do not allow cleaners to stay on hot surfaces, which can cause streaking or fumes.
- Apply a pea-sized amount of cleaner to the center of a damp pad; rotate in a circular motion over the surface.
- Rinse and wipe with a clean, dry cloth after the advised contact time to prevent film buildup.
- For stubborn stains, let the cleaner sit for a couple of minutes before buffing; avoid letting cleaner dry completely.
- Always test on a small inconspicuous area first to verify finish compatibility.

Practical buying guide for 2026
When selecting a stove-top cleaner in 2026, consider the following decision framework. First, assess your cooktop material and heat exposure, then match to a product with proven surface compatibility and minimal residue. Second, evaluate time-to-clean metrics and whether you prefer a no-rinse formula or one that requires a quick rinse. Third, factor in the value of an all-in-one kit versus standalone cleaners based on your shopping preferences and storage space. Decision framework helps ensure you choose a durable, low-effort option.
- If you cook on glass-ceramic surfaces daily, prioritize a no-rinse, streak-free cleaner with a dedicated buffing cloth.
- For heavy usage and occasional burnt-on stains, select a robust degreaser with clear usage guidelines and safety data.
- For convenience, consider an all-in-one kit that includes scraper tools for safety and efficiency.
